2 - I don't know about checking for your future maximum height, but I do have a few ways of estimating your current "true height.". These are estimates so I make no claims for accuracy.

a) Measure from fingertip to fingertip.
b) Pick a spot at the top of your spine and the bottom of your spine. Measure between the two points with a ruler. Now, run a string from one point to the other, following the curve of your spine. Measure the lenght of the string between the two points. Subtract the first value from the second. Add the result to your standing height to get your true height.
c) I got this info from a friend on another site.
=====
Here is another way, and is from the MUST tool which is used in hospitals. You use the measurement from your wrist (the prominent bone) to the point of your elbow to calculate your height according to sex and age. Scroll down to the last page in the pdf.

http://www.bapen.org.uk/pdfs/must/must_f...
=====

If I remember right, the numbers in the pdf are in centimeters. To convert from inches to centimeters, multiply inches by 2.54 to get centimeters. To convert from centimeters to inches, divide centimeters by 2.54 to get inches.
